Virtual Manufacturing versus Challenges in Lightweight Vehicle Programmes


Introduction
The paper presents a brief summary of three different R&D projects carried out in collaboration between ESI Group and a number of academic and industrial partners. All projects are directly related to producing parts for lightweight vehicles whilst each one focuses on a different application, material or manufacturing process. It also provides an answer for the question above by demonstrating how a new simulation-based-solution is been developed based on existing tools. Respectively, the first project (LoCoLite) focuses on producing complex shape parts using hot forming of aluminium sheets; the second (Grain- Refiner) focuses on improving properties of sand-casted aluminium components by adding a novel grain-refiner; and the third one focuses on the use of multiaxial non-crimp fabrics of carbon fibres in automotive.
